How to relieve gastroenteritis when it strikes

Acute gastroenteritis attacks are very painful for patients, mainly pain and diarrhea. Self-treatment is not recommended, and prompt medical attention must be sought, and symptoms can be relieved by rehydration, anti-infection, correction of acidosis, and correction of electrolyte disorders during emergency or digestive outpatient visits. The recovery period can follow the daily personal experience of health care, such as eating fewer meals and a lighter diet with low protein, easily digestible, fine and soft foods that do not increase the gastrointestinal burden. There is a term in clinical Chinese medicine called food regain, after acute gastroenteritis has improved, suddenly too much intake of food, or too much intake of food that is not easy to digest, the condition will recur, called food regain, so the diet must be taken under the guidance of a professional doctor. After acute gastroenteritis gets better, you should pay attention to rest, rest is a necessary treatment. Chronic gastroenteritis can be treated for the cause and mechanism of the disease.
